您现在的位置是:首页-> 米鼠技术 ->一个有趣的JS

一个有趣的JS

随机效果文本-定时的从一段文本中随机选择一个字符,改变颜色

<font size="3">&lt;</font>!doctype html public "-//w3c//dtd html 4.0 transitional//en"<font size="3">&gt;</font>
<font size="3">&lt;</font>html<font size="3">&gt;</font>
<font size="3">&lt;</font>head<font size="3">&gt;</font>
<font size="3">&lt;</font>script language="javascript"<font size="3">&gt;</font>
<font size="3">&lt;</font>!--
function open () {return true;}
//--
<font size="3">&gt;</font>
<font size="3">&lt;</font>/script<font size="3">&gt;</font>
<font size="3">&lt;</font>title<font size="3">&gt;</font>ripple text examples by mark boyle email mboil@hotmail.com<font size="3">&lt;</font>/title<font size="3">&gt;</font>
<font size="3">&lt;</font>/head<font size="3">&gt;</font>

<font size="3">&lt;</font>body bgcolor=green text="white" bgcolor="green" link="yellow" vlink="yellow"  
alink="red"
<font size="3">&gt;</font>
<font size="3">&lt;</font>font color="yellow"<font size="3">&gt;</font>


<font size="3">&lt;</font>script language="javascript"<font size="3">&gt;</font>

var speed = 20;
var fulltext;

if(navigator.appname == "netscape")
document.write(
<font size="3">&lt;</font>layer id="wds"<font size="3">&gt;</font><font size="3">&lt;</font>/layer<font size="3">&gt;</font><font size="3">&lt;</font>br<font size="3">&gt;</font>);
if (navigator.appversion.indexof("msie") != -1)
document.write(
<font size="3">&lt;</font>span id="wds"<font size="3">&gt;</font><font size="3">&lt;</font>/span<font size="3">&gt;</font><font size="3">&lt;</font>br<font size="3">&gt;</font>);


function livetext()
{
fulltext="this is an example of random effect text"
var whichchar=math.round((math.random()*fulltext.length))
switch(whichchar){
case 0:
fulltext =
<font size="3">&lt;</font>font color="red"<font size="3">&gt;</font> + fulltext.substring(0,1) + <font size="3">&lt;</font>/font<font size="3">&gt;</font> + fulltext.substring
(1,fulltext.length);
break;
case fulltext.length:
fulltext = fulltext.substring(0,fulltext.length-1) +
<font size="3">&lt;</font>font color="red"<font size="3">&gt;</font> + fulltext.substring
(fulltext.length-1,fulltext.length) +
<font size="3">&lt;</font>/font<font size="3">&gt;</font>;
break;
default:
fulltext =  
fulltext.substring(0,whichchar) +
<font size="3">&lt;</font>font color="violet"<font size="3">&gt;</font> +
fulltext.substring(whichchar,whichchar+1) +
<font size="3">&lt;</font>/font<font size="3">&gt;</font> +
fulltext.substring(whichchar+1,fulltext.length);
break;
}
if(navigator.appname == "netscape") {
size = "
<font size="3">&lt;</font>font point-size=25pt<font size="3">&gt;</font>";  
document.wds.document.write(size+
<font size="3">&lt;</font>center<font size="3">&gt;</font> + fulltext + <font size="3">&lt;</font>/center<font size="3">&gt;</font><font size="3">&lt;</font>/font<font size="3">&gt;</font>);
document.wds.document.close();
}
if (navigator.appversion.indexof("msie") != -1){
wds.innerhtml =
<font size="3">&lt;</font>center<font size="3">&gt;</font> + fulltext + <font size="3">&lt;</font>/center<font size="3">&gt;</font><font size="3">&lt;</font>p<font size="3">&gt;</font>;
wds.style.fontsize=25px
   }

settimeout("livetext()",speed);
}

livetext()

<font size="3">&lt;</font>/script<font size="3">&gt;</font>

<font size="3">&lt;</font>/font<font size="3">&gt;</font>

<font size="3">&lt;</font>/body<font size="3">&gt;</font>
<font size="3">&lt;</font>/html<font size="3">&gt;</font>
 


热点文章
最新项目
相关文章 最新文章